Generally, lactic acid fermentation is carried out by bacteria such as Lactobacillus and yeast. It is an anaerobic fermentation reaction that occurs in some bacteria and animal cells, such as muscle cells. Lactate dehydrogenase catalyzes the interconversion of pyruvate and lactate with concomitant interconversion of NADH and NAD+. In homolactic fermentation, one molecule of glucose is ultimately converted to two molecules of lactic acid. This occurs routinely in mammalian red blood cells and in skeletal muscle that does not have enough oxygen to allow aerobic respiration to continue (such as in muscles after hard exercise). Homofermentative bacteria convert glucose to two molecules of lactate and use this reaction to perform substrate-level phosphorylation to make two molecules of ATP: Heterofermentative bacteria produce less lactate and less ATP, but produce several other end products: Examples include Leuconostoc mesenteroides, Lactobacillus bifermentous, and Leconostoc lactis. Lactic acid is produced by lactic acid producing bacteria (LAB) such as lactobacillus of which there are all sorts of different strains. [10][18] The primary bacteria used are typically Lactobacillus bulgaricus and Streptococcus thermophilus, and United States as well as European law requires all yogurts to contain these two cultures (though others may be added as probiotic cultures).
